Output 2868d591038e0559aa2a934051e68dbbe4a8828a20d8dd1fa44f3814658c92c2:0

value
81088
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e4c1ebf4f183ce7dbcda19980cbfd0d1f18acdb9 OP_EQUAL
address
3NYaJCQVidQuPXriv2NtwWVEVD9KBJ5g8h
transaction
2868d591038e0559aa2a934051e68dbbe4a8828a20d8dd1fa44f3814658c92c2
confirmations
137979
spent
true